About Dr Thomas Gin

Dr Thomas Gin is an Ophthalmologist and fellowship-trained medical retina specialist with expertise in cataract surgery and retinal disorders including age-related macular degeneration, diabetic eye disease and retinal vascular disorders. Dr Gin graduated with honours in Medicine from the University of Melbourne in 2013, achieving the top rank in his clinical school final-year examinations. Following his residency, he completed ophthalmology surgical training based at the Royal Victorian Eye & Ear Hospital in Melbourne. Subsequently, he completed further fellowship training in medical retina. With a commitment to serving both private and public sectors, Dr Gin remains engaged in research and teaching. He has authored research articles on age-related macular degeneration. Additionally, he contributes to the education and training of trainee ophthalmologists in his role as a consultant at the Royal Victorian Eye & Ear and Austin Hospitals.
